NOS A1200 , screen flickers when accessing floppy
Hiya!
a close friend of mine just got a NOS Commodore A1200 and uses it with a 1240 accelerator and an A500 "heavy" PSU. The screen flickers in regions when a floppy disk is accessed. We also tried without the 1240 installed, but nothing changed... Is there a solution to this problem? |

I had a feeling you might have tried it already, You say NOS A1200, If it was purchased form Amigakit then I suggest it goes back my friend. I would say it has "Capacitor" issues & is unable to keep the supply stable when extra load is required, ie the floppy drive motor. TC |

today i fix one of my 2 A1200 ,with same problem.. the Mboard is 1.D4
all OK now, the flicker is no more i use one cap 1μF - 50V (smaller of guide but stronger voltage) Edit: oh and polarized is: (-)on the left, (+) on the right.. |
